After a decade of summoning the shadows, Verboden Festival has evolved from a modest Vancouver experiment into one of North America’s most vital gatherings for darkwave, post-punk, and industrial devotees. Founded in 2016, the festival has become a refuge for the beautifully strange: the misfits, romantics, and creatures of the night who thrive under strobes, smoke, and synths.
In 2026, Verboden marks its 10-year anniversary with its boldest move yet: expanding across the Pacific Northwest with simultaneous events in Vancouver, Seattle, and Portland on May 28th-31st. This tri-city evolution unites three creative undergrounds into one circuit of sound and subculture, amplifying Verboden’s mission to illuminate the darker edge of modern music.
Headliners:
Male Tears channel the mascara-streaked glamour of forgotten VHS nights into a body of work steeped in queer futurism and electronic melancholy. Their synthpop, equal parts sleaze and sincerity, nods to Soft Cell and early Pet Shop Boys, but bristles with the irony and heartbreak of the digital age.
Sacred Skin trades in neon nostalgia and existential yearning. Drawing from the gloss of ’80s synthpop and the ache of post-punk romanticism, they reimagine pop’s luminous artifice as something wounded and devotional. Each song feels like a confession overheard through fog and fluorescent light.
The alias of Kennedy Ashlyn, SRSQ (pronounced “seer-eskew”) turns grief into grandeur. Her voice cuts through reverb like revelation: operatic yet human, trembling at the edge of transcendence. SRSQ’s work sits between dream and elegy, where beauty and loss share the same pulse.
Boise-born producer and performance artist Street Fever embodies industrial catharsis in its rawest form. Blending EBM, trap, and sacred fury, they create rituals rather than shows: sermons of sweat, sin, and strobe. It’s music for confession booths lit by police lights, where faith, flesh, and machine collapse into one.
Supporting artists include Blone Noble, Carrellee, Ceremony Shadows, Dark Chisme, Hot Hail, Hallows, H.Ä.L.T., More Ephemerol, Sleek Teeth, Somber Violets… more to be announced!
Verboden’s 2026 edition is a celebration of endurance and evolution, a decade of devotion to underground art and the people who keep it alive, celebrating the artists who define the current era of darkwave, post-punk, industrial, and EBM.
What began as a local gathering for devotees of alternative sound has transformed into a continental phenomenon: one that bridges generations of artists, DJs, and fans who live for the pulse of underground nightlife. Over the years, Verboden has hosted genre stalwarts, rising icons, and cross-disciplinary performers whose work blurs the boundaries between music, performance, and art.
